Is it me or does that only have one gun? I thought Tornadoes had two.

2 27mm Mausers originally. The ADV ( Air Defence Variant ) interceptor deleted the left one for fuel or avionics. Eventually the IDS ( strike version ) lost the left one too, probly for avionics.
